9. Your Rights

Under the GDPR, you have the following rights regarding your personal data:

Right to Access

You can request a copy of the personal data we hold about you.

Right to Rectification

You can request correction of any inaccurate or incomplete data.

Right to Erasure

You can request the deletion of your personal data under certain conditions.

Right to Restrict Processing

You can request that we limit the processing of your personal data.

Right to Data Portability

You can request to receive your personal data in a structured, commonly used, and machine-readable format, and have the right to transmit those data to another controller.

Right to Object

You can object to the processing of your personal data in certain circumstances.

If we process your data based on your consent, you can withdraw your consent at any time.
